Monitor Description

While the engine is being cranked, positive battery voltage is applied to terminal STA of the ECM. If the starter signal (STA) is not detected by the ECM when the engine is started, it determines that there is a malfunction in the STA circuit. The ECM then illuminates the MIL and stores the DTC.

DTC No. Detection Item DTC Detection Condition Trouble Area MIL Note
P0615-14 Starter Relay Circuit Short to Ground or Open All of the following conditions are met (2 trip detection logic):
  1. (a) The vehicle speed is 4 km/h (2.49 mph) or less.
  2. (b) The engine status changed from stopped to running.
  3. (c) The STA signal is off.
  • Starter relay (ST) circuit
  • ECM
Comes on SAE Code: P0616
